    DOCX import: lazy-read images without external headers
    
    So that similar to ODT, images are not loaded on file open, only when
    the user scrolls there.
    
    Notes:
    
    1) GraphicDescriptor::ImpDetectJPG() would try to calculate the logic
    size before the pixel size is available, so the logic size would be 0x0.
    Also, ImpGraphic::ImplSetPrepared() would always work with a pixel map
    mode. Any of these two would result in a failure of
    testDMLShapeFillBitmapCrop in CppunitTest_sw_ooxmlexport6.
    
    2) Lazy-loading seems to (at the moment) not recognize EMF files, so
    don't lazy-load in case an external header is provided. This probably
    has to be revisited, since the ODF import doesn't go via
    GraphicProvider::queryGraphic().
